Teledyne FLIR signs deal to install recon systems on Bulgaria’s Stryker vehicles

Teledyne FLIR Defense has secured a $32 million contract to supply reconnaissance and surveillance sensor kits for Bulgaria’s Stryker armored vehicles, the company confirmed.
